Wolves Appoint Abdullahi As New Chief Coach
Published: July 10, 2016
Nigeria Professional Football League side Warri Wolves have appointed Mansur Abdullahi as their new chief coach.
The former Bayelsa Queens coach will work with technical adviser Ard Sluis to move the Seasiders forward in their quest for success in the 2016 campaign.
“We want to assure the fans that this is the best decision we have taken for the team,” an insider at the club told our reporter.
“The management has promised to continue to back and support the technical crew to achieve their targets."
Mansur has managed Olga Queens, Bayelsa Queens and NIMC FC in addition to assistant coaching positions in the Nigeria women senior national team and the Flamingoes.
He holds a CAF B License Certificate.
